Warner Bros. has released a new Ready Player One TV spot, and it has me returning to my mantra about the film, “Trust in Spielberg.” That’s not to say that director Steven Spielberg has never made a bad movie, but if he hasn’t earned the benefit of the doubt, then no one has. The question that I keep coming back to with Ready Player One is it just a nonstop celebration of IP, or does it actually critique our interest and unquestioning devotion to IP.

Sadly, in this TV spot, it looks like the former as Percival (the avatar of human Wade Watts) proudly proclaims you can “climb Mt. Everest with Batman!” before we get a list of beloved characters including the Iron Giant, Lex Luthor, Chucky, and Kong while A-ha’s “Take on Me” plays in the background. It seems like mindless celebration where every character is divorced from what makes them special. If you just throw them all together, they become devoid of context and then it’s just a celebration of things and nostalgia. That could make for a grueling experience. But I trust in Spielberg.

Here’s the official synopsis for Ready Player One:

The film is set in 2045, with the real world on the brink of chaos and collapse. But people have found salvation in the OASIS, an immersive virtual universe where you can go anywhere, do anything, be anyone. The OASIS was created by the brilliant and eccentric James Halliday (Mark Rylance). When Halliday died, he left his immense fortune, and total control of the OASIS, to the first person to win three keys, unlocking the door to a digital Easter egg he hid somewhere in his seemingly infinite creation. His challenge launched a game that gripped the entire world, but after five years the scoreboard remained tauntingly empty...until now.

 

An unlikely young hero named Wade Watts (Tye Sheridan)—under his avatar name, Parzival—finally conquers the first contest, instantly becoming a celebrity...and a target. Ruthless corporate mogul Nolan Sorrento (Ben Mendelsohn) proves he will stop at nothing to beat Wade and take over the OASIS, and suddenly the virtual stakes are all-too-real. Ultimately realizing he cannot win alone, Wade joins forces with his friends—now the High Five (Sheridan, Olivia Cooke, Lena Waithe, Philip Zhao, Win Morisaki). Together, they are hurled into a reality-bending treasure hunt through a fantastical universe of discovery and danger to save the OASIS.
